Innovations from Origin - Sauces, Spreads, and Snacks

Cacao is an ingredient like no other: known worldwide for chocolate, yet so much more than what ends up in the bar. Visionary makers across the globe are tapping into every part of the cacao tree—seeds, juicy fruit pulp, cacao bean shells, and boldly colored pods—to create a palette of flavors and textures we’ve never tasted before. From indulgent spreads and irresistible snacks, to skin-nourishing cosmetics and even sustainable textiles, these products redefine what’s possible with cacao. Every bite, drizzle or sensual touch also supports sustainability, reduces waste, and gives a brighter future to cacao-growing communities.

Flavorings, Sauces, and Spreads

Cacao’s seeds, fruit, and even shells are bursting with potential, delivering unexpected complexity and zest to your kitchen. These delicious products use more of the cacao pod, making every bite a win for flavor and the planet.

Balsamic Reductions

Mashpi Chocolate Cacao Pulp Reduction

Mashpi Chocolate Cacao Pulp Reduction - Ecuador
Slow-cooked from 100% cacao fruit pulp to seal in bright, tropical flavors, this reduction is perfect over fresh fruit, yogurt, cheese, or even ice cream. A tangy-sweet finish brightens every dish.

 

 

Mais do Cacau Mellato Cacao Pulp Reduction - Brazil

Mais do Cacau Mellato Cacao Pulp Reduction - Brazil
Reminiscent of honey, this thick cacao pulp reduction pours easily and brings vibrant fruity notes to breakfast, desserts, salads, or cocktails.

 

 

Mindo Chocolate Cacao Honey - Ecuador

Mindo Chocolate Cacao Honey - Ecuador
Pure cacao pulp gently cooked to create a naturally sweet, aromatic drizzle for cheese boards, fruit, or your favorite breakfast spread.

 

 

Afrodisiak Cacao Pulp Reduction - Ecuador
Aged in oak barrels for a balsamic-like tang, this cacao “honey” has layers of sweetness and acidity that intrigue on everything from salads to grilled veggies.

Salad Dressings & Sauces

Afrodisiak Pineapple Cocoa Dip - Ecuador
Pineapple and cocoa vinegar come together in a tropical vinaigrette with sweet-sour balance, making salads, seafood, and plant-based bowls pop.

Afrodisiak Barrel-Aged Cocoa Vinegar - Ecuador
Cocoa vinegar slowly aged in toasted oak brings depth and subtle sweetness—transforming dressings, roasted meats, or even creative drinks with its layered flavor.

Mindo Chocolate Cacao BBQ Sauce - Ecuador

Mindo Chocolate Cacao BBQ Sauce - Ecuador
This vegan, gluten-free BBQ sauce winds together the fruity notes of cacao pulp and the earthiness of cacao bean shells with herbs and spice. An adventurous way to sauce up grilled dishes or roasted veggies.



Pantry Staples

Mais do Cacau Cocoa Balsamic and Traditional Vinegar - Brazil

Mais do Cacau Cocoa Balsamic Vinegar - Brazil
Aged cocoa fruit pulp forms the base of this oak-matured vinegar—bold, sour-sweet, and a pantry staple for salads, glazes, and savory marinades.

Mais do Cacau Cocoa Traditional Vinegar - Brazil
Cold-pressed cocoa nectar slowly transformed into vinegar, adding gentle fruit acidity for creative cooks everywhere.

 

Cocoa Supply Freeze-Dried Cacao Fruit Pulp Ecuador

Cocoa Supply Freeze-Dried Cacao Fruit Pulp - Ecuador
100% pure cacao fruit pulp transformed into a powder for a punch of tang in baking, popsicles, or smoothie bowls—a shelf-stable, minimally processed way to embrace cacao’s “honey”.

 

 

Cocoa Supply Cacao Fruit Puree Nectar Ecuador

Cocoa Supply Cacao Fruit Puree Nectar - Ecuador
Pasteurized, undiluted cacao pulp with a luscious, exotic flavor profile—ready for sorbets, smoothies, sauces, and adventurous cocktails.

 

 

KOA Dried Fruit Flakes Ghana - Felchlin

KOA Dried Cacao Fruit Flakes — Ghana
Crunchy, golden flakes made from nothing but cacao pulp. Their natural sweetness with hints of lychee, peach, and honey is a great addition to granola, desserts, and fruit salads.



 


 


Spreads

Belu Almond Chocolate Spread El Salvador

Belú Almond Chocolate Spread - El Salvador
Pure, rich chocolate flavor and creamy texture shine in this three-ingredient spread—Salvadorian cacao, almonds, and unrefined cane sugar. Enjoy on toast, fruit, or straight from the jar.

 

 

Pridi Cacaofevier Cashew Chocolate Spread Thailand

Pridi Cacaofevier Cashew Chocolate Spread - Thailand
Creamy, almost milk-chocolatey spread made with fresh-roasted cashews and flavorful cacao beans, crafted for a decadently smooth finish.

 

 

Dengo Cacao Jelly — Brazil
Sweet, silky cacao fruit jelly that brightens toast, brings life to cheese boards, or elevates classic PB&J with a chocolate-lover’s upgrade.

Dengo Cashews & Nib Cream — Brazil
Dreamy layers of cashew and macadamia nut cream blended with crunchy cocoa nibs—perfect as a topping for bread, waffles, fruit, or your favorite desserts.

Snacks

Cacao as a snack goes way beyond chocolate. Across the cacao belt, origin makers are transforming the seeds, pulp, fruit, and shells into snacks with new flavor dimensions and intriguing textures. Using more of the cacao pod means less waste, products perfectly suited for warm climates, and wider local benefits.

Cocoa Supply Freeze-Dried Cacao Fruit Bites Ecuador

Cocoa Supply Freeze-Dried Cacao Fruit Bites - Ecuador
Pure, freeze-dried cacao fruit pulp in snackable chunks with a gentle, tropical tang and satisfying crunch. Enjoy right out of the bag or as a topping for yogurt and smoothie bowls.

 

 

Ohene Cocoa Crunch Bars Ghana

Ohene Cocoa Crunch - Ghana
Lightly roasted cocoa nibs with a hint of sugar, blended simply or combined with peanut, coconut, or ginger for a craveable, not-too-sweet bite crafted from fresh Ghanaian ingredients.

 

 

Quetzal Cacao Confit de Cacao Panama

Quetzal Cacao Confit de Cacao - Panama
Whole fruit cacao candy created by the traditional confit process until the fruit is chewy and sweet, wrapped around a crisp cacao bean. Affectionately called “crack” by Quetzal’s clients, it’s contrast of fruity and chocolatey notes is irresistible.

 

 

Mashpi Chocolate Taro-Based Brownie Mix Ecuador

Mashpi Chocolate Taro-Based Brownie Mix - Ecuador
Rich brownies made with heirloom Cacao Nacional Fino de Aroma and nutrient-dense taro flour (papa china), perfect for those seeking a gluten-free, sustainable chocolate treat.

 

 

Mais do Cacau Granola with Tapioca and Coconut Brazil

Mais do Cacau Granola with Tapioca and Coconut - Brazil
A Bahian-inspired granola combining sweetened cacao, coconut, and tapioca crisps; delicious for breakfast, desserts, or as a crunchy snack any time.

 

 

 

Mais do Cacau Candied Nibs Brazil

Mais do Cacau Candied Nibs - Brazil
Cocoa nibs caramelized with brown sugar for a truly portable, chocolatey crunch that won’t melt even in the tropics.

 

 

 

Mais do Cacau Amêndoa de Cacau Caramelizada Brazil

Mais do Cacau Amêndoa de Cacau Caramelizada - Brazil
Sun-dried, roasted whole cocoa beans coated in demerara sugar for rich flavor and crunch.

 

 

 

Why Innovations in Origins Matter:

These flavor-packed creations use cacao seeds, fruit, and even the cacao bean shell, turning more of this superfruit into delicious drizzles, spreads, and pantry must-haves. By highlighting every delicious part of the cacao pod, they preserve much of the fruit that’s usually lost in chocolate-making. Even in warm tropical environments, most are shelf-stable, require little processing or artificial ingredients, and maximize farmer income while minimizing waste—delivering inventive flavors and positive impact while reducing food system waste.
